StefanBB Posted August 24, 2021 Share Posted August 24, 2021 PSV vs Benfica Despite losing in the first leg in Lisbon, PSV has an active result, and anything is still possible in this tie. However, things didn’t look that bright at halftime, as Roger Schmidt’s side trailed 2:0. Nevertheless, Cody Gakpo managed to find the opposition’s net and keep his team competitive in this tie. Apart from that defeat, PSV has been excellent this season. They trashed fierce rivals Ajax in the Dutch Super Cup, while the hosts also opened the Eredivisie campaign with two victories. The home side has been pretty efficient, as they scored in each of their last nine matches. PSV needs to continue that trend as it is the only way to book a place in the Champions League group stage. Benfica has been booking nothing but wins since the start of the season. The Eagles eliminated Spartak Moscow in the previous round, while they also have a perfect record in Liga Portugal. Interestingly, Jorge Jesus’ side scored two goals in each of the six matches played so far. On the other hand, the visitors have been pretty disciplined in the back, conceding just twice. However, they will miss Haris Seferovic for the Eindhoven game since the Swiss international is out injured. Nevertheless, Benfica aims for a place in the group stage and seeks another disciplined performance. StefanBB Posted August 24, 2021 Share Posted August 24, 2021 Shakhtar vs Monaco Shakhtar is on a good track to securing the Champions League group stage spot after celebrating a narrow 1:0 victory in Monaco. The hosts are on a hot streak, as they booked four straight wins. During that run, Roberto De Zerbi’s side conceded just one goal while scoring twice per game on average. Lassina Traore and the lads are one point behind the leading Dynamo Kyiv in the Ukrainian Premier League and head to this clash after a 3:0 victory over Chornomorets on the road. Shakhtar already eliminated Genk, and the home side is just one step away from a place in the group stage. They need another disciplined performance to join the best 32 European teams. On the other hand, Monaco seems to be in real trouble. Niko Kovac’s side has a very slow start, and the visitors are still searching for their first victory in Ligue 1. Kevin Volland and the lads have trouble finding the back of the oppositions’ net, and they failed to score three times in a row. Monaco picked up just one point in Ligue 1 this season, scoring only once. The away side was confident against Sparta Prague, though, and they need the same recipe for this tie. However, their rival is much more challenging, and Monaco will have a tough task to overturn Shakhtar’s advantage at the away ground. These games are really hard to cap.Betting models so early in the season are thrown out the window.Today I wil try to approach a game I like (Shaktar vs Monaco) using common sense by studying both teams production so far. Let's take a look at Shakhtar Donetsk as it's the team that has the most official games ,under it's belt, so far in the season (8) as opposed to Monaco (6), Shakhtar's 6/8 games have produced >2.5 goals. Shakhtar's 4/8 games have ended in BTTS & Over 2.5 Shakhtar is currently riding a 3 game clean sheet streak. Shakhtar has scored in each game so far. Monaco on the other hand have been atrocious in Ligue 1 yet managed to manhandle Slavia Prague in two games in the previous CL qualifying round. Currently they are being heralded as slight favorites on various booking sites at around 2.30 which makes you wonder....considering how bad they've been the past days. Monaco hasn't managed to score in it's last three games despite the talented players they have. Monaco has no choice but to attack early and I find it unlikely they go scoreless for a 4th consecutive game as well as I find it unlikely Shakhtar keeps a clean sheet for a 4th consecutive game. Based on their recent performance and in order to chase value we'll have to pick a bet from other markets from the usual ones(At least that's what we found out yesterday after the 0-0 stalement of PSV-Benfica where veryone was expecting goals.) Monaco just does not convince me that they will all of a sudden flip the switch and beat Shakhtar which is a team that is playing very well and has experience in the competition.Keep in mind that Shakhtar is playing for two results (Win or Draw gets them through) and they seem to have the talent to attack and counter attack.
